Hong Kong battle begins for tycoon’s billions

The charitable foundation established by Nina Wang, the Hong Kong tycoon, fired its first shot in the battle for her $3.9bn (€2.6bn, £2bn) estate on Friday, taking aim at a reclusive businessman who also claims to be her heir.

The Chinachem Charitable Foundation filed court papers in Hong Kong arguing that Ms Wang, who died last April, might have been too ill in late 2006 to approve a will that bequeathed her estate to Tony Chan. Ms Wang was diagnosed with cancer in 2004.
